UK Under-16 Social Media Ban: How 50,000 Followers Spark a Legal Rights Debate

The UK’s proposed ban on social media for under-16s faces opposition from parents whose children earn income through platforms like TikTok. Families argue the ban would violate their right to raise digital-native children as they see fit, while regulators insist youth mental health justifies intervention. The clash spotlights unresolved questions about children’s digital rights, parental autonomy, and the enforceability of age-gating laws.

Florida AG sues TikTok over under-14 ban, joining 25+ state AG actions

Florida Attorney General James Uthmeier has filed a lawsuit against TikTok in state court, alleging the platform violates a law that prohibits social media accounts for children under 14. The complaint adds a novel statutory claim to a national wave of litigation, testing the enforceability of age-gating mandates and the limits of state police power over online platforms.

Investors Sue Trump and Bondi Over TikTok Divestiture Interference

A group of institutional investors has filed a federal lawsuit against Donald Trump and Pam Bondi, alleging that their interference in the TikTok sale process caused significant financial losses. The complaint asserts that political maneuvering and back-channel negotiations artificially depressed the platform's valuation during a critical divestiture window.

Anti-Corruption Group Challenges Trump-Brokered TikTok Sale in Federal Court

A prominent anti-corruption watchdog has filed a lawsuit against Donald Trump, alleging ethical breaches and a lack of transparency in the forced sale of TikTok's U.S. operations. The legal challenge threatens to stall the multi-billion dollar divestiture and raises critical questions about executive overreach in private corporate transactions.
